Understanding Simulations in Education



Simulations are artificial representations of real-world processes or systems. They are designed to mimic the behavior of the actual environment in which the students are learning. The use of simulations in education can take many forms, including computer-based simulations, role-playing, or even physical models.

Types of Simulations



1. Computer Simulations: These involve software that mimics real-world processes. For example, flight simulators are used in aviation training.
2. Role-Playing Simulations: In these simulations, students take on roles and act out scenarios, which can help develop skills like negotiation or conflict resolution.
3. Physical Simulations: These could include building models or conducting experiments in a laboratory setting.

Benefits of Using Simulations



- Engagement: Simulations often lead to higher levels of student engagement compared to traditional learning methods.
- Real-World Application: They allow students to apply theoretical knowledge in practical situations.
- Immediate Feedback: Many simulations provide instant feedback, which helps learners understand their mistakes and learn from them.
- Skill Development: Simulations can enhance critical thinking, problem-solving, and decision-making skills.

Answering Simulation Test Questions



When it comes to answering simulation test questions, there are several key strategies to keep in mind:

Read Instructions Carefully



- Take the time to understand the requirements of the simulation. Misinterpretation of the instructions can lead to errors that could have been avoided.
- Look for keywords in the instructions that indicate what is expected (e.g., "analyze," "create," "evaluate").

Approach Questions Systematically



- Break down questions into manageable parts. This can help ensure that you address each component adequately.
- Use bullet points or numbered lists to organize your thoughts and responses clearly.

Utilize Available Resources



- Many simulations come with additional resources such as help buttons, tutorial videos, or even FAQs. Make sure to utilize these tools to aid your understanding.
- If permitted, refer to notes or textbooks during the simulation. This can be particularly helpful for recalling specific details.

Time Management



- Keep an eye on the time to ensure you complete all parts of the test. Allocate time based on the number of questions and their complexity.
- If you find yourself stuck on a question, it may be better to move on and return to it later rather than risk running out of time.

Common Mistakes to Avoid



Even with thorough preparation, students may still fall into certain traps when taking simulation tests. Here are some common mistakes to avoid:

1. Rushing Through Questions: It’s easy to rush through a simulation, especially if you feel pressured by time. Take your time to think through each question.
2. Ignoring Feedback: If the simulation provides feedback, don't ignore it. Use it as a learning tool to adjust your approach in real-time.
3. Neglecting to Review: If time permits, always review your answers before submitting. This can help catch any mistakes or oversights.
4. Overthinking: Sometimes students overthink questions, leading to confusion. Trust your preparation and instincts.
